Dust Bowl Electric Shock. The dust bowl refers to the drought‑stricken southern plains of the united states, which suffered severe dust storms during the great depression of the 1930s. The dust blasted through the cracks in window frames and under doors, blinded people, and smothered cattle to death. The dust bowl was the result of a period of severe dust storms that greatly damaged the ecology and agriculture of the american and canadian prairies.
